The Shadowed Labyrinth
The sun dipped below the horizon, casting long shadows over the cobblestone streets of the city of Elysium. The air was thick with the scent of autumn leaves, and the wind carried the distant hum of the city's ever-busy life. But for young Elara, the night held a different kind of magic.
Elara was no ordinary scribe; she had been chosen by the ancient order of the Tempus Keepers to safeguard the secrets of time. Her father, a keeper, had taught her the art of reading the stars and the signs that whispered of the past and future. But tonight, as she sat in her small room, her fingers tracing the lines of an ancient scroll, she felt an unease that had never been there before.
The scroll spoke of a prophecy, a tale of a vanishing sun that heralded the end of an age and the rise of a new one. It spoke of a labyrinth, a place where time itself was fluid, and the past, present, and future danced together in a dance of fate. The scroll hinted at a key, a piece of knowledge hidden within the labyrinth that could alter the very course of time.
As Elara read, a vision came to her, a vision of the labyrinth itself, its towering walls made of swirling, time-worn stone. She saw herself standing at the entrance, her heart pounding with fear and excitement. She knew she had to go.
The next morning, Elara found herself at the heart of the labyrinth, the walls closing in around her. The air was cool and damp, and the only light came from the distant glow of the vanishing sun. She felt a strange connection to the place, as if it called to her with a voice she couldn't quite hear.
As she ventured deeper, she encountered strange creatures, beings of light and shadow, each with a story of their own. Some spoke of love, others of loss, and still others of the eternal battle between light and darkness. Elara learned that the labyrinth was a place of memory, a place where the past and future were intertwined, and where the key to the prophecy could be found.
The key, she discovered, was not a physical object but a piece of knowledge, a truth that had been lost to time. It was the understanding that the vanishing sun was not an end but a rebirth, a time of change and growth. It was a truth that could only be revealed by those who were brave enough to face the darkness within themselves.
Elara's journey through the labyrinth was fraught with danger. She encountered guardians of time, beings who sought to protect the knowledge within the labyrinth at any cost. Each guardian tested her resolve, her understanding, and her heart. Through her trials, Elara learned that the greatest power was not in the knowledge itself, but in the courage to face the truth.
As the vanishing sun began to rise, Elara stood at the center of the labyrinth, the key to the prophecy in her heart. She knew that the time had come for the world to change, for the old to make way for the new. With a deep breath, she reached out and touched the sun, feeling its warmth and light fill her being.
In that moment, the labyrinth around her began to fade, the walls becoming transparent and the creatures of light and shadow melting away. Elara found herself back in her room, the scroll still in her hand, but now with a new understanding.
The prophecy had been fulfilled, not with a vanishing sun, but with the dawn of a new age. Elara knew that her journey was far from over, that she had only just begun to understand the true power of time and the magic that lay within her.
The city of Elysium stirred to life, and Elara stepped outside, her heart full of purpose. She was a keeper of time, a scribe of the ancient prophecy, and she was ready to face whatever the future held.
